Just remember: ANYONE who gets the Democratic nomination is always painted as "an extreme liberal." They've been doing it since Reagan made it a bad word. Mondale: liberal. Dukakis: liberal. Clinton: liberal liberal liberal.

It has nothing to do with the political spectrum; it's the right taking advantage of the fact that they've managed to give the word a bad connotation in the minds of the average non-thinking voter. And the right-wing punditocracy goes along with it, because it's in their best interest. Take a look at how they all now refer to the "Democrat party." Frank Luntz did polling on it in the 80s, and found that it sounds harsher and reflects more negatively -- and so the GOP, both pundits and politicians, have adopted it virtually whole-hog now.
